Binary calculator

=
Binary1011011110001010011111
Decimal3007135
Hexadecimal2DE29F
Bits22
Equation2097152 + 524288 + 262144 + 65536 + 32768 + 16384 + 8192 + 512 + 128 + 16 + 8 + 4 + 2 + 1
Decimal Binary Spelt
+20971521000000000000000000000Two million ninety-seven thousand one hundred fifty-two
+52428810000000000000000000Five hundred twenty-four thousand two hundred eighty-eight
+2621441000000000000000000Two hundred sixty-two thousand one hundred forty-four
+6553610000000000000000Sixty-five thousand five hundred thirty-six
+327681000000000000000Thirty-two thousand seven hundred sixty-eight
+16384100000000000000Sixteen thousand three hundred eighty-four
+819210000000000000Eight thousand one hundred ninety-two
+5121000000000Five hundred twelve
+12810000000One hundred twenty-eight
+1610000Sixteen
+81000Eight
+4100Four
+210Two
+11One
= 3007135 1011011110001010011111 Three million seven thousand one hundred thirty-five

8-bit numbers: 10100000 01110111 01000101 00011010 01010010 01100010 11101011 01001110 10101100 11100111

16-bit numbers: 1010110001001011 0001011001001110 0101001000111010 1011010110111100 0111110011010001 0010101101000100 0010011110111100 0001101000100000 1101010111010110 1011010000010001

More numbers: 10001000111001101111101001110100001110100010011011110101110010111001100011010001100111101100001111000100010000010000111110111111000110111000011011101110001100110110110100001110100011011010000111111101001011011011001111010101001001101001111011100000101100110000011001010000000001010101011001010100010110001011110011111000110101000010011010110110110110011101111110011100011000011000001111100011001110001011110110100111101010001010001011010100010111000101100011111001001111011000101010100100110001010001000101111010011101100100001010101010011001000001010110011100111010000000000101001011001010000110011101111011110011011010111001101011010110101000101011111111011100011111111011101010001011101110100101101001100011101010101010100011111100110010001110011100110100001110111011110010001010100000001101001000111001001100100111000011001100001110000011100001001000011001001110110100001100001110001100101111111100101011111011011110100010110101101010111100110011111100011000111001110101011110110010110101011110101010111100101001000010111110011101010101100110111101101110000011010100111010000100000010011111101110110001011101011010100001001001011100010011111100101000001000101101011101000010101001000000000010011111001111000001100111001111100001010011100100010001001111000001110010001101101111111011100110011000000111111110011010000101000011100110110000111010000110011010101001001010011110000011000010010001100111000001001011011010001111001010011100110110110010100101001011010111000101101110001101011011010111000101111111011010101010010111001010001100010101111110111001000001010111110101111110110000100011110010110011111101000011110010001010110101010001110011111111001111101100001101011111111010001110101011010010010010101110011001011100000000110001101111100011111010101000111101011101110110101110011010111000111101100000111011101101011111101110111000100001011101010101011101100001010000110101010000101110101001100111